Airport Ground Transit: Arriving in Sapporo

Getting from CTS airport to the city center

New Chitose Airport (CTS) to Sapporo city center via JR Rapid Airport train takes approximately 37 minutes

Route Briefing: Dubai to Sapporo

Flying from Dubai to Sapporo is one of those routes that rewards the traveller willing to go the extra mile — or in this case, about 6,500 of them. At roughly 11 hours and 30 minutes with a connection, typically through Tokyo or Osaka, this journey takes you from the desert heat of the Gulf to one of Japan's most dramatically different landscapes. Emirates, Japan Airlines, and ANA all serve this corridor well, and routing through Tokyo's Narita or Haneda airports tends to give you the most flexibility and competitive pricing. If you catch a good deal — anything under $700 roundtrip — you'd be wise to snap it up immediately, because standard fares regularly climb past $1,000.

Sapporo sits on Japan's northernmost main island of Hokkaido, and it carries a personality quite distinct from the rest of the country. It's younger, more spacious, and refreshingly unhurried compared to Tokyo or Osaka. The city is famous worldwide for its Snow Festival held each February, when enormous ice sculptures transform the central Odori Park into something genuinely surreal. But Sapporo's appeal isn't limited to that single event — the surrounding region is home to some of Asia's finest powder skiing, particularly at resorts like Niseko and Furano, which draw serious skiers from across the Middle East, Australia, and beyond. Winter here, from December through February, is peak season for good reason.

Summer is equally compelling if crowds and cold aren't your thing. July and August bring mild temperatures, lavender fields in full bloom across Hokkaido's countryside, and fresh seafood that's among the best in Japan — think sea urchin, crab, and salmon in quantities that feel almost indulgent. Sapporo's ramen, a rich miso-based variety, is considered a national treasure, and the local beer has been brewed here since the 19th century.

From New Chitose Airport, getting into the city is straightforward and efficient — a direct train connects the airport to central Sapporo in under an hour, which is exactly what you want after a long-haul journey.

The smartest move on this route is to book two to four months ahead, especially if you're targeting the ski season. Winter flights fill quickly as demand from the Gulf region for Hokkaido's snow has grown considerably in recent years. Locking in early not only secures better fares but gives you time to plan accommodation in the mountain resort areas, which also sell out fast. Travel this route once and you'll understand immediately why Sapporo has quietly become one of Japan's most beloved destinations.
